WebJun 30, 2024 · What does with haste mean? noun. swiftness of motion; speed; celerity: He performed his task with great haste. They felt the need for haste. urgent need of quick action; a hurry or rush: to be in haste to get ahead in the world. unnecessarily quick action; thoughtless, rash, or undue speed: Haste makes waste. WebSep 17, 2024 · post-haste (adv.) post-haste. (adv.) "with urgent speed, with all possible haste," 1590s, from a noun (1530s) meaning "great speed," usually said to be from "post haste," an instruction formerly written on letters (attested from 1530s), from post (adv.) + haste (n.). The phrase originated in the old system of relaying messages by post horses ...
